星地直连系统及星地直连终端数据处理方法与流程

文档序号:22083483发布日期:2020-09-01 19:44阅读:170来源:国知局
星地直连系统及星地直连终端数据处理方法与流程

本发明涉及卫星通信技术领域,尤其涉及一种星地直连系统及星地直连终端数据处理方法。



背景技术:

星地直连终端可以不经过中转站直接与卫星进行通信,是在传统移动通信网络无法覆盖区域的重要通信手段。随着卫星应用的不断拓展,如天基物联网、天基互联网,星地直连终端的重要性日益彰显。由于星地直连终端主要采用野外或海上大面积部署或随身携带的方式被使用。因此,便携性和待机时间是衡量星地直连终端的重要性能指标。

由于应用的需要,越来越多的传感器被集成到同一终端中,终端所采集的数据量也随之增加。但星地直连终端的能源、尺寸、重量、环境适应性等因素极大地限制了终端的数据处理能力。在有限的计算资源下,对大量数据进行处理,将给终端带来巨大的能源消耗,从而缩短终端的待机时间。



技术实现要素:

为解决上述现有技术中存在的技术问题,本发明提供了一种星地直连系统及星地直连终端数据处理方法。具体技术方案如下:

第一方面,提供了一种星地直连系统,所述系统包括:星地直连终端、移动站和卫星;所述移动站用于与所述星地直连终端和所述卫星进行通信,并具备数据处理和存储功能;所述星地直连终端与所述移动站建立连接将部分或全部计算任务分配给所述移动站。

在一种可能的设计中,所述移动站包括:卫星通信天线、终端通信天线、数据处理模块和数据存储模块;所述卫星通信天线用于与所述卫星进行通信;所述终端通信天线用于与所述星地直连终端进行通信;所述数据处理模块用于为所述星地直连终端提供计算服务;所述数据存储模块用于存储所述星地直连终端发来的数据及数据处理结果。

在一种可能的设计中,所述数据处理模块采用移动边缘计算技术将计算资源进行整合,以虚拟机或容器的方式为所述星地直连终端提供计算服务。

第二方面,提供了一种如上述任一项所述的星地直连系统中星地直连终端的数据处理方法,所述方法包括:

星地直连终端有计算任务时,搜索有无可连接的移动站;

当无可连接的移动站时,星地直连终端在本地对数据进行处理;

当有可连接的移动站时,星地直连终端选择其中信号最强的移动站作为目标移动站,并与目标移动站建立连接;

星地直连终端测试与目标移动站间网络宽带,比较将数据发送到目标移动站处理的能源开销和本地计算的能源开销;

若本地计算的能源开销小于或等于发送到目标移动站处理的能源开销,星地直连终端在本地对数据进行处理;

若本地计算的能源开销大于发送到目标移动站处理的能源开销,星地直连终端发送需要处理的数据到目标移动站;

目标移动站对数据进行处理,并将处理结果返回给星地直连终端。

在一种可能的设计中,将数据发送给目标移动站处理的能源开销通过下述公式一确定:

式中,er为将数据发送给目标移动站处理的能源开销,d0为需要处理的数据量,dr为处理后结果的数据量,b为星地直连终端测得的与目标移动站间的链路带宽,et为传输数据时单位时间内的能源开销。

在一种可能的设计中,星地直连终端将数据本地计算的能源开销通过下式公式二确定:

式中,el为本地计算的能源开销,c0为当前计算任务下数据量为d0时的计算量,r为星地直连终端当前可用的计算资源,ec为单位时间内计算资源的能源开销。

在一种可能的设计中,所述方法还包括:

事先对星地直连终端上可能运行的计算任务在单位数据下的计算结果数据量进行测量,确定计算任务中数据量与结果数据量量的对应关系,并将测量结果存储在星地直连终端中;

星地直连终端在计算将数据发送给目标移动站处理的能源开销时,根据存储的测量结果确定当前计算任务下数据量为d0时的结果数据量dr。

在一种可能的设计中,所述方法还包括:

事先对星地直连终端上可能运行的计算任务在单位数据下的计算量进行测量,确定计算任务中数据量与计算量的对应关系,并将测量结果存储在星地直连终端中;

星地直连终端在确定本地计算资源的能源开销时,根据存储的测量结果确定当前计算任务下数据量为d0时的计算量c0。

本发明技术方案的主要优点如下:

本发明的星地直连系统及星地直连终端数据处理方法,通过移动边缘计算技术,运用移动站为星地直连终端分摊运算任务,从而降低星地直连终端的运算量,达到延长星地直连终端待机时间的目的。且星地直连终端通过比较将数据发送到移动站处理的能源开销和本地计算的能源开销来决定数据处理方式,能避免移动边缘计算对星地直连终端能源开销带来负面影响。

附图说明

此处所说明的附图用来提供对本发明实施例的进一步理解,构成本发明的一部分,本发明的示意性实施例及其说明用于解释本发明,并不构成对本发明的不当限定。在附图中:

图1为本发明一实施例提供的星地直连系统的架构图;

图2为本发明一实施例提供的星地直连终端数据处理方法流程图。

具体实施方式

为使本发明的目的、技术方案和优点更加清楚,下面将结合本发明具体实施例及相应的附图对本发明技术方案进行清楚、完整地描述。显然,所描述的实施例仅是本发明的一部分实施例,而不是全部的实施例。基于本发明的实施例,本领域普通技术人员在没有做出创造性劳动前提下所获得的所有其他实施例,都属于本发明保护的范围。

以下结合附图,详细说明本发明实施例提供的技术方案。

第一方面,本发明实施例提供了一种星地直连系统,如附图1所示,该系统包括:星地直连终端、移动站和卫星。移动站用于与星地直连终端和卫星进行通信,并具备数据处理和存储功能,移动站采用移动边缘计算部署为边缘计算平台。星地直连终端与移动站建立连接将部分或全部计算任务分配给移动站。

本发明实施例提供的星地直连系统中,星地直连终端通过移动边缘计算技术,可以选择性地运用移动站为星地直连终端分摊运算任务,从而降低星地直连终端的运算量,降低能源消耗,达到延长星地直连终端待机时间的目的。

具体地,对于移动站的结构,以下进行示例说明:

如附图1所示,移动站包括:卫星通信天线、终端通信天线、数据处理模块和数据存储模块。卫星通信天线用于与卫星进行通信;终端通信天线用于与星地直连终端进行通信;数据处理模块用于为星地直连终端提供计算服务;数据存储模块用于存储星地直连终端发来的数据及数据处理结果。

如此设置,移动站中具备终端通信天线和卫星通信天线,能同时与星地直连终端和卫星实现连接,为星地直连终端提供计算服务不会对移动站自身的任务产生影响。并且,移动站中的数据存储模块能为星地直连终端提供数据存储服务,降低星地直连终端对存储空间的需求。

其中,数据处理模块采用移动边缘计算技术将计算资源进行整合,以虚拟机或容器的方式为星地直连终端提供计算服务。如此设置,使移动站能同时接收多个星地直连终端的计算请求,并实现各个计算任务间的隔离。

第二方面,本发明实施例提供了一种如上述任一项的星地直连系统中星地直连终端的数据处理方法,如附图2所示,该方法包括:

星地直连终端有计算任务时,搜索有无可连接的移动站。一般地,星地直连终端可否与移动站建立连接通过星地直连终端信号范围确定;星地直连终端信号覆盖范围内有移动站时,能与移动站建立连接,如附图1中的星地直连终端1。星地直连终端信号覆盖范围内无移动站时,不能与移动站建立连接,如附图1中的星地直连终端2。

当无可连接的移动站时,星地直连终端在本地对数据进行处理。如附图1中的星地直连终端2。

当有可连接的移动站时,星地直连终端选择其中信号最强的移动站作为目标移动站,并与目标移动站建立连接。如附图1中的星地直连终端1。选择信号最强的移动站作为目标移动站可以使星地直连终端与目标移动站间传输数据的能源开销较小,起到节能目的。

星地直连终端测试与目标移动站间网络宽带,比较将数据发送到目标移动站处理的能源开销和本地计算的能源开销。

若本地计算的能源开销小于或等于发送到目标移动站处理的能源开销,星地直连终端在本地对数据进行处理。

若本地计算的能源开销大于发送到目标移动站处理的能源开销,星地直连终端发送需要处理的数据到目标移动站。

目标移动站对数据进行处理,并将处理结果返回给星地直连终端。

本发明实施例提供的星地直连终端数据处理方法,通过移动边缘计算技术,运用移动站为星地直连终端分摊运算任务,从而降低星地直连终端的运算量,达到延长星地直连终端待机时间的目的。且星地直连终端通过比较将数据发送到移动站处理的能源开销和本地计算的能源开销来决定数据处理方式,避免移动边缘计算对星地直连终端能源开销带来负面影响。

其中,将数据发送给目标移动站处理的能源开销通过下述公式一确定:

式中,er为将数据发送给目标移动站处理的能源开销,d0为需要处理的数据量,dr为处理后结果的数据量,b为终端测得的与移动站间的链路带宽,et为传输数据时单位时间内的能源开销。

星地直连终端将数据本地计算的能源开销通过下式公式二确定:

式中,el为本地计算的能源开销,c0为当前计算任务下数据量为d0时的计算量,r为星地直连终端当前可用的计算资源,ec为单位时间内计算资源的能源开销。

对特定的星地直连终端而言,其采集的数据及数据处理方法相对固定,因此,对于特定的星地直连终端而言,其可能运行的计算任务中数据量与计算结果数据量之间存在固定的对应关系。基于此,本发明实施例提供的星地直连终端数据处理方法还包括:

事先对星地直连终端上可能运行的计算任务在单位数据下的计算结果数据量进行测量,确定计算任务中数据量与结果数据量量的对应关系,并将测量结果存储在星地直连终端中;星地直连终端在确定本地计算资源的能源开销时,根据存储的测量结果确定当前计算任务下数据量为d0时的结果数据量dr。

对特定的星地直连终端而言,其采集的数据及数据处理方法相对固定,因此,对于特定的星地直连终端而言,其可能运行的计算任务中计算量与数据量之间存在固定的对应关系。基于此,本发明实施例提供的星地直连终端数据处理方法还包括:

事先对星地直连终端上可能运行的计算任务在单位数据下的计算量进行测量,确定计算任务中数据量与计算量的对应关系,并将测量结果存储在星地直连终端中;星地直连终端在确定本地计算资源的能源开销时,根据存储的测量结果确定当前计算任务下数据量为d0时的计算量c0。

综上所述,本发明实施例提供的星地直连系统及星地直连终端数据处理方法具备以下有益效果:

1、利用卫星移动站为星地直连终端分摊运算任务,从而降低星地直连终端的运算量,达到延长星地直连终端待机时间的目的。

2、移动站能同时与星地直连终端和卫星实现连接。因此,为星地直连终端提供计算服务不会对移动站自身的任务产生影响。而且,移动站可为星地直连终端提供数据存储服务,降低终端对存储空间的需求。

3、星地直连终端通过比较将数据发送到移动站处理的能源开销和本地计算的能源开销来决定数据处理方式,能避免移动边缘计算对星地直连终端能源开销带来负面影响。

需要说明的是,在本文中,诸如“第一”和“第二”等之类的关系术语仅仅用来将一个实体或者操作与另一个实体或操作区分开来,而不一定要求或者暗示这些实体或操作之间存在任何这种实际的关系或者顺序。而且,术语“包括”、“包含”或者其任何其他变体意在涵盖非排他性的包含,从而使得包括一系列要素的过程、方法、物品或者设备不仅包括那些要素,而且还包括没有明确列出的其他要素,或者是还包括为这种过程、方法、物品或者设备所固有的要素。此外,本文中“前”、“后”、“左”、“右”、“上”、“下”均以附图中表示的放置状态为参照。

最后应说明的是:以上实施例仅用于说明本发明的技术方案,而非对其限制;尽管参照前述实施例对本发明进行了详细的说明,本领域的普通技术人员应当理解:其依然可以对前述各实施例所记载的技术方案进行修改,或者对其中部分技术特征进行等同替换;而这些修改或者替换,并不使相应技术方案的本质脱离本发明各实施例技术方案的精神和范围。

当前第1页1 2 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1